Sexuality is an essential part of human life. It brings about pleasure, emotional fulfillment, and even procreation. Sex education provides individuals with necessary knowledge that helps them make informed decisions regarding their sexual lives.

Research suggests that early exposure to sex education has lasting effects on people's sexual behaviors, decision-making, responsibilities, and confidence. This essay will discuss how early exposure to sex education shapes adult sexual decision-making, responsibility, and confidence.

Early Exposure to Sex Education and Decision-Making

Early exposure to sex education significantly influences how people make decisions regarding their sexual lives.

Those who receive comprehensive sex education at an earlier age are more likely to know about contraceptive methods such as condoms and birth control pills. They also understand the consequences of unprotected sex and engage in safe practices like condom usage during intercourse. Such knowledge enables them to take charge of their reproductive health and prevent unwanted pregnancies or STIs.

Early sex education exposes individuals to different types of relationships and teaches them that sexual intimacy should be mutually beneficial and respectful.

Impact of Early Sex Education on Responsibility

Early exposure to sex education can promote responsible sexual behavior among adults. Those who receive proper sex education tend to be less promiscuous, practice safer sex, and delay their first sexual encounter. The knowledge gained from this education informs them on how to communicate effectively with their partners and develop healthy sexual relationships.

They understand the risks associated with unhealthy sexual practices and avoid them. In contrast, those who lack early sex education may engage in irresponsible behavior due to ignorance or peer pressure.

Effect of Early Sex Education on Confidence

Early exposure to sex education helps build confidence in adults. It instills a sense of self-worth and reduces anxiety related to sexual exploration. Individuals become comfortable with their bodies and can confidently express their desires without fear of judgment. Moreover, they learn to trust themselves and others in their sexual decision-making, which boosts self-esteem. Consequently, early sex education fosters empowerment and makes it easier for people to navigate their sexual lives confidently.

Early exposure to sex education has long-lasting effects on adult sexuality, including decision-making, responsibility, and confidence. This education equips individuals with necessary skills and information to make informed decisions and lead fulfilling sexual lives. Therefore, parents and educators must provide comprehensive sex education at an early age to create informed adults who can take charge of their reproductive health and have rewarding sexual experiences.
